|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: While driving at any speed engine check light came on and stayed on. vehicle was taken to the dealer, who removed the engine check light sensor. vehicle had been to dealer six times for this particular problem. currently, engine check light would not come on even when the key was in the on position. consumer felt that this might cause more serious problems in the future.*ak |
